Trump to 'clean out' and own Gaza - Seyed Mohammad Marandi, Alexander Mercouris & Glenn Diesen
This discussion features Seyed Mohammad Marandi, a professor and advisor on Iranian nuclear negotiations, who delves into the complexities of U.S. foreign policy regarding the Israeli-Palestinian conflict. He critiques Trump's unpredictable approach, linking it to historical strategies of intimidation. The conversation also covers Iran's growing geopolitical alliances with BRICS and the implications for U.S.-Iran relations. Additionally, Marandi sheds light on Turkey's challenges in the Syrian conflict and the importance of recognizing a multipolar Eurasian landscape.

Iran's Impending Retaliation - Seyed Mohammad Marandi, Alexander Mercouris & Glenn Diesen
Seyed Mohammad Marandi, an Iranian affairs expert, joins geopolitical analyst Alexander Mercouris and international relations professor Glenn Diesen to dissect tensions in the Middle East. They explore Iran's dilemma of potential retaliation against Israel while weighing escalation risks. The trio discusses historical Western conflicts, global shifts post-Soviet Union, and Iran's evolving alliances, especially with Russia. They also delve into regional anxieties and Iran's strategic responses, illuminating the complexities shaping contemporary geopolitics.

Iran and Israel at war? - Seyed Mohammad Marandi, Alexander Mercouris & Glenn Diesen
Experts Seyed Mohammad Marandi, Alexander Mercouris, and Glenn Diesen discuss Iran's calculated strategies against Israel and the US, including recent military actions, Iran's historical attacks on Israel, and potential future plans. They analyze the attack on the embassy in Damascus, Israel's strategic challenges, global outrage against Israel, and the importance of seeking peace over maximalist victory in the Israeli-Palestinian conflict.
